‘Melody Queen' Asha Bhosle With Granddaughter Zanai At Mumbai Airport

It's not every day that fans get to witness the legendary Asha Bhosle in a public moment and her granddaughter Zanai Bhosle's presence made it even more heartwarming. Melody Queen Asha Bhosle was once again spotted at the Mumbai airport, accompanied by her son Anand Bhosle and granddaughter Zanai Bhosle. The adorable and rare family moment instantly caught the paparazzi's attention, who couldn't resist capturing it through their lenses. In a video that's now doing the rounds online, the trio is seen stepping into the airport as Anand and Zanai lovingly guide Asha ji by her hands. The family paused to smile for the cameras, with Zanai even greeting the paparazzi with a cheerful 'Bye, have a nice day." Asha Bhosle's airport look In this heartwarming airport moment, Asha Bhosle is seen draped in a pastel green floral saree, layered with a white shawl and completed her elegant look with a maroon bindi. The saree-clad legend once again proved that simplicity and charm never go out of style. All eyes, however, were also on Zanai Bhosle, the young singer and Asha Bhosle's granddaughter, who made a style statement in an all-white outfit. Her look featured a fitted blazer paired with ripped jeans and a black inner top. With open hair, minimal accessories and a sleek designer tote in hand, Zanai balanced her chic vibe with a touch of airport comfort. Walking beside them was Anand Bhosle, who kept it simple in a blue-striped shirt and relaxed blue trousers. The grandmother-granddaughter duo has earlier shared the stage during singing shows, and their bond continues to charm fans. Last year in December, Asha Bhosle, 91, released a new single song, Saiyaan Bina, as a soulful tribute to the music maestro and her late husband, RD Burman, fondly known as Pancham Da. The release, presented by Apnidhun, featured Zanai as part of the collaboration. In a heartfelt caption accompanying the release, the production house wrote, 'A Dream Realised, A Legacy Continued. Presenting a soul-stirring melody featuring the legendary Asha Bhosle Tai, gracing us with her timeless voice at the age of 91—truly a miracle that defines her unmatched passion for music. Joining her on this special journey is her granddaughter Zanai Bhosle, carrying forward the legacy with grace and promise." It added, 'This heartfelt collaboration is not just a song; it's a testament to the power of dreams, dedication, and the beauty of family bonds in music." Her debut song with the band was a modern rendition of Hil Pori Hila, originally sung by Usha Mangeshkar in 1973. The music video featured 25 underprivileged children from Mumbai's Salaam Bombay Foundation. In 2020, she lent her voice to the spiritual track Tera Hi Ehsas Hai for spiritual guru Sri Sri Ravi Shankar. Asha Bhosle once shared in an interview that Zanai began training in Indian classical music at the age of 7, and is also trained in Western opera. 'Zanai doesn't trouble me at all! She cooks well and lovingly feeds me. She is deeply rooted in our sabhyata and binds the family together," the legendary singer fondly said.
